Mariette Nowak

Mariette Nowak's book, Birdscaping in the Midwest, has been favorably reviewed by naturalist Randy Hoffman, ecologist Jim Steffen, ornithologist Stephen Kress, botanist Gerould Wilhelm and many others.

Mariette was the Director of the Wehr Nature Center in Milwaukee County, Wisconsin for 18 years. An avid birder, she is a member of the Lakeland Audubon Society and former board members of the Wisconsin Society of Ornithology. She is also active in the Wild Ones: Native Plants, Natural Landscapes organization and is President and founder of the Wild Ones Kettle Moraine Chapter. In addition, Mariette serves on her county's Park Committee.

Mariette and her husband have created a bird sanctuary on their 2-acre property in Southeastern Wisconsin and enjoy hiking and birding in natural areas and parks..
